Ethereum Foundation Deploys AI Agents to Hunt Security Vulnerabilities Artificial Intelligence Is Transforming Blockchain Security

The Ethereum Foundation has revealed that it is deploying multiple AI agents to automatically identify security vulnerabilities within the Ethereum protocol before attackers can exploit them. Rather than relying solely on manual security audits or traditional bug bounty programs, these AI systems are tasked with analyzing source code, smart contracts, cryptographic systems, and network infrastructure to uncover potential weaknesses.
During testing, the AI agents successfully discovered several real-world vulnerabilities, including a critical flaw in libp2p gossipsub—the networking protocol responsible for propagating data between Ethereum nodes. The vulnerability was patched before it could be exploited. This development highlights AI's growing role as a critical cybersecurity tool, particularly for blockchain networks that secure trillions of dollars in digital assets.

Why Is the Ethereum Foundation Using AI Agents to Find Vulnerabilities?

Ethereum is the world's second-largest blockchain, securing hundreds of billions of dollars in assets while supporting thousands of decentralized applications. Even a single vulnerability in the protocol could potentially result in losses worth millions—or even billions—of dollars.
For years, vulnerability discovery has relied primarily on security researchers, audit firms, and bug bounty programs. While these approaches have uncovered numerous critical issues, they also face inherent limitations.

The Codebase Continues to Grow

Ethereum is constantly evolving through upgrades that improve scalability, privacy, and performance.
As a result, the amount of code requiring security review continues to expand, making comprehensive manual analysis increasingly time-consuming and resource-intensive.

Hackers Are Also Using AI

Blockchain developers are not the only ones embracing artificial intelligence.
Cybercriminals are increasingly leveraging AI to analyze source code, identify vulnerabilities, and automate attack strategies.
This has made AI-powered defense essential for blockchain projects seeking to keep pace with increasingly sophisticated attack techniques.

Earlier Vulnerability Detection

AI systems can operate around the clock while processing enormous volumes of data in a relatively short period.
This allows the Ethereum Foundation to identify potential issues during development rather than after deployment—or worse, after exploitation.
 

What Parts of Ethereum Are AI Agents Examining?

According to the Ethereum Foundation, AI is not limited to analyzing smart contracts.
Instead, it is being deployed across multiple layers of the Ethereum ecosystem.

Protocol Source Code

AI reviews core protocol code to detect logic errors, abnormal conditions, and scenarios that could compromise security.

Smart Contracts

Smart contracts secure enormous amounts of value on Ethereum.
AI assists in identifying issues such as:
Unauthorized access
Asset management errors
Unsafe execution conditions
Potential exploit scenarios

Cryptographic Systems

AI also analyzes cryptographic algorithms and libraries to identify implementation flaws or weaknesses that could compromise network security.

Networking Protocols

AI examines the networking components responsible for communication between Ethereum nodes, ensuring data is transmitted correctly while reducing the risk of attacks targeting network infrastructure.
Analyzing multiple layers simultaneously enables AI to develop a more comprehensive understanding of Ethereum's overall attack surface.
 

AI Has Already Discovered a Real-World Vulnerability

One of the initiative's most notable achievements was the discovery of a vulnerability within libp2p gossipsub, the communication protocol used by Ethereum nodes to exchange data.
This protocol is a critical component of Ethereum's peer-to-peer networking layer.
A serious flaw in this system could potentially disrupt node operations or interfere with network synchronization.
After the AI system flagged the issue, security experts reviewed and verified the finding, confirming that it represented a legitimate vulnerability.
The development team subsequently released a patch before the flaw could be exploited in the wild.
This demonstrates that AI has moved beyond theoretical applications and is already making practical contributions to improving blockchain security.
 

AI Does Not Replace Security Experts

Despite its advantages, the Ethereum Foundation emphasizes that AI cannot fully replace human expertise.

AI Can Produce False Positives

During code analysis, AI may flag many sections of code as potentially vulnerable, even though not all represent genuine security issues.
Without human validation, these false positives could waste valuable time and engineering resources.

Humans Make the Final Decisions

Every AI-generated finding undergoes multiple stages of review, including:
Accuracy verification
Exploit scenario development
Impact assessment
Reproducibility testing
Remediation planning
This process minimizes the risk of applying unnecessary patches while ensuring genuine vulnerabilities are properly addressed.

AI Serves as an Assistant

Rather than replacing security professionals, AI allows them to focus on higher-value tasks.
Repetitive work—such as reviewing millions of lines of code—can be automated, while human experts concentrate on security analysis, risk assessment, and final decision-making.
